WOW: Cataclysm Release Date Announced

October 4, 2010 by Gameranx Staff

Blizzard announces, WOW: Cataclysm releasing December 7, 2010

Blizzard has announced the release date for its third expansion set for World of Warcraft, following the last expansion Wrath of the Lich King. WOW: Cataclysm is set to release December 7, 2010 for the PC and MAC at a retail price of $39.99, and will be available in digital format through the Blizzard store. A retail only collector’s edition will also be available for $79.99 on release date.

Mike Morhaime, CEO and cofounder of Blizzard Entertainment, said,

Cataclysm includes the best content we’ve ever created for World of Warcraft. It’s not just an expansion, but a re-creation of much of the original Azeroth, complete with epic new high-level adventures for current players and a redesigned leveling experience for those just starting out. With the help of our beta testers, we’re putting on the final polish, and we look forward to welcoming gamers around the world to enjoy it in just a couple of months.

World of Warcraft: Cataclysm Story details

While the attention of the Horde and Alliance remained fixed upon Northrend, an ancient evil has been lying dormant within Deepholm, the domain of earth in the Elemental Plane. Hidden away in a secluded sanctuary, the corrupted Dragon Aspect Deathwing has waited, recovering from the wounds of his last battle against Azeroth, nursing his hatred for the inferior creatures that infest the surface realm…and biding his time until he can reforge the world in molten fire.
Soon, Deathwing the Destroyer will return to Azeroth, and his eruption from Deepholm will sunder the world, leaving a festering wound across the continents. As the Horde and Alliance race to the epicenter of the cataclysm, the kingdoms of Azeroth will witness seismic shifts in power, the kindling of a war of the elements, and the emergence of unlikely heroes who will rise up to protect their scarred and broken world from utter devastation.
The face of Azeroth is altered forever as the destruction left in Deathwing’s wake reshapes the land and reveals secrets long sealed away. Players will be able to re-experience familiar zones across Kalimdor and the Eastern Kingdoms, rewrought by the cataclysm and filled with new opportunities for adventure.

Some of the new features of World of Warcraft: Cataclysm include:

+ Two New Playable Races:
Adventure as one of two new races–the cursed worgen with the Alliance or the resourceful goblins with the Horde.

+ Level Cap Increased to 85:
Earn new abilities, tap into new talents, and progress through the path system, a new way for players to improve characters.

+ Classic Zones Remade:
Familiar zones across the original continents of Kalimdor and the Eastern Kingdoms have been altered forever and updated with new content, from the devastated Badlands to the broken Barrens, which has been sundered in two.

+ New High-Level Zones:
Explore newly opened parts of the world, including Uldum, Grim Batol, and the great Sunken City of Vashj’ir beneath the sea.

+ More Raid Content than Ever Before:
Enjoy more high-level raid content than previous expansions, with optional more challenging versions of all encounters.

+ New Race and Class Combinations:
Explore Azeroth as a gnome priest, blood elf warrior, or one of the other never-before-available race and class combinations.

+ Guild Advancement:
Progress as a guild to earn guild levels and guild achievements.

+ New PvP Zone & Rated Battlegrounds:
Take on PvP objectives and daily quests on Tol Barad Island, a new Wintergrasp-like zone, and wage war in all-new rated Battlegrounds.

+ Archaeology:
Master a new secondary profession to unearth valuable artifacts and earn unique rewards.

+ Flying Mounts in Azeroth:
Explore Kalimdor and the Eastern Kingdoms like never before.
